Piaram - Boarijor, Godda

Piaram is a village situated in the Boarijor subdivision of Godda district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 42 km from the tehsil headquarters in Boarijor and around 30 km from the district headquarters in Godda. Lilatari 1 serves as the Gram Panchayat for Piaram village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Piaram is 356371. The village covers a total geographical area of 274 hectares and falls under the 814155 pincode.

Piaram village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head.

Population of Piaram

According to the 2011 Census, Piaram village had a total population of 729 people, including 363 males and 366 females, living in 170 households. The sex ratio was 1,008 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 18.60%, with male literacy at 25.09% and female literacy at 12.37%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 318.

Transport and Connectivity of Piaram

Public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the Piaram. The nearest railway station is Mirza Cheuki,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 61.0 km.
